CONTENTS:This vendor-independent 3-days course covers design, deployment and measurement of a generic EPC Network. The course demonstrates how EPC traffic analysis drives design and deployment for EPC nodes such as MME, SGW, PGW, HSS and PCRF. Furthermore the course examines mobility management and measurements related to the PDN-GW for a GTP based S5/S8. Measurements related to the MBMS GW and PCRF as well as Load Balancing and Overload Control mechanisms for EPC nodes are covered. Generic walkthrough of EPC Measurement and EPC KPI?s are based on 3GPP specifications.

WHO SHOULD ATTEND:This course is for professionals working with EPC with good knowledge of the functional elements in EPC.
